prostate-specific antigen
n. Abbr. PSA
A protease secreted by the epithelial cells of the prostate gland. Serum levels are elevated in patients with benign prostatic hyperplasia and prostate cancer.

Prostate-specific antigen (PSA)
A substance that often is produced by cancers of the prostate. It can be detected in a blood test.
